Works well with Lenovo and other devices
This is a 65W usb-c charger. It supports multiple output modes up to 65W (automatic switching):20V/3.25A, 20.3V/3A, 15V/3A, 12V/3A, 9V/3A, 5V/3ACheck your device for compatibility. The posting has a list of compatible devices but others may also work. Note that some units requiring 5V with 1.5-2A may not be compatible.There is not much to say about this unit except that it works. Tried it with Lenovo laptop, HP laptop, and a Pixel phone. The units all showed proper charging and the brick didn't heat up even at 65W.One thing to note regarding laptop chargers - some computers will complain if you use anything other than their own brand charger. This does not necessarily mean that the charger isn't working properly, a lot of times it means that the company is trying to sell more accessories at ridiculous prices. USB-C charging follows standards on power request (both Volts and Amps) so there is no inherent reason for off-brand chargers not to work. Make your own informed decision if you want the piece of mind of branded chargers or not.
